I think M&D is probably his best by any attempt at objective measure, but Gravity's Rainbow was the most fun for me, in part because it was my first experience getting totally lost in that kind of insane world. (Literary fiction writers never have that kind of imagination; genre fiction writers never have that kind of prose.)

I haven't read Against the Day or Vineland yet.

>>6398300
Like Inherent Vice pretty much. FBI conspiracy, druggies and protestors, ex-old ladies, TV. I haven't quite finished it yet but so far I would say they're directly comparable and about equal in quality.

There are long expositional memories, though. Like multiple chapters in length. I've been learning about Prairie's mom for like 160 pages.
